Fix NS3: --enable-threading no longer valid or needed
authorClaudio-Daniel Freire <claudio-daniel.freire@inria.fr>
Wed, 7 Sep 2011 02:45:17 +0000 (04:45 +0200)
committerClaudio-Daniel Freire <claudio-daniel.freire@inria.fr>
Wed, 7 Sep 2011 02:45:17 +0000 (04:45 +0200)
src/nepi/testbeds/planetlab/application.py
test/testbeds/planetlab/integration_ns3.py

index 32644c1..c3d65d4 100644 (file)
@@ -883,7 +883,7 @@ class NS3Dependency(Dependency):
                      "python setup.py install --install-lib ${BUILD}/target && "
                      "python setup.py clean && "
                      "cd ../ns3-src && "
-                     "./waf configure --prefix=${BUILD}/target --with-pybindgen=../pybindgen-src -d release --disable-examples --disable-tests --enable-threading && "
+                     "./waf configure --prefix=${BUILD}/target --with-pybindgen=../pybindgen-src -d release --disable-examples --disable-tests && "
                      "./waf &&"
                      "./waf install && "
                      "rm -f ${BUILD}/target/lib/*.so && "
index c79e98f..13cc41c 100755 (executable)
@@ -198,6 +198,7 @@ class PlanetLabCrossIntegrationTestCase(unittest.TestCase):
         ns1if.set_attribute_value("label", "ns1if")
         ns1.connector("devs").connect(ns1if.connector("node"))
         tap1.connector("fd->").connect(ns1if.connector("->fd"))
+        tap1.set_attribute_value("tun_cipher", "PLAIN")
         ip1 = ns1if.add_address()
         ip1.set_attribute_value("Address", "192.168.2.3")
         ip1.set_attribute_value("NetPrefix", 24)
@@ -285,6 +286,7 @@ class PlanetLabCrossIntegrationTestCase(unittest.TestCase):
         ns1if.set_attribute_value("label", "ns1if")
         ns1.connector("devs").connect(ns1if.connector("node"))
         tap1.connector("fd->").connect(ns1if.connector("->fd"))
+        tap1.set_attribute_value("tun_cipher", "PLAIN")
         ip1 = ns1if.add_address()
         ip1.set_attribute_value("Address", "192.168.2.3")
         ip1.set_attribute_value("NetPrefix", 24)
@@ -398,6 +400,7 @@ class PlanetLabCrossIntegrationTestCase(unittest.TestCase):
         ns1if.set_attribute_value("label", "ns1if")
         ns1.connector("devs").connect(ns1if.connector("node"))
         tap0.connector("fd->").connect(ns1if.connector("->fd"))
+        tap0.set_attribute_value("tun_cipher", "PLAIN")
         ip1 = ns1if.add_address()
         ip1.set_attribute_value("Address", "192.168.2.1")
         ip1.set_attribute_value("NetPrefix", 30)